Section 2: Software Innovations and Computational Advances

The rapid evolution of software technologies has revolutionized the field of mathematical modeling, enabling professionals to tackle complex problems with unprecedented speed and accuracy. Recent innovations in computational power, cloud computing, and specialized software packages have expanded the possibilities for mathematical modeling, allowing for larger-scale simulations, more accurate predictions, and faster processing times. For example, the development of open-source software packages like Python's NumPy and SciPy has democratized access to advanced mathematical modeling tools, while cloud-based platforms like AWS and Google Cloud have enabled professionals to scale their computations and collaborate more effectively. Furthermore, the integration of machine learning algorithms and artificial intelligence techniques is enhancing the capabilities of mathematical modeling software, enabling professionals to analyze complex systems and make predictions with greater precision.

Section 3: Future Developments and Skill Sets

As the field of mathematical modeling with software continues to evolve, it's essential for professionals to stay up-to-date with the latest trends and innovations. One of the key future developments in this field is the increasing focus on explainability, transparency, and interpretability of mathematical models. With the growing use of machine learning and artificial intelligence, professionals will need to develop skills in model interpretability, ethics, and communication to ensure that their solutions are not only effective but also responsible and trustworthy. Additionally, the rise of emerging technologies like quantum computing and the Internet of Things (IoT) will require professionals to adapt their mathematical modeling skills to new domains and applications. To remain relevant, professionals should focus on developing a strong foundation in programming languages, data analysis, and software development, as well as cultivating skills in communication, collaboration, and problem-solving.
